This is a pair of Japanese dwarf flying squirrels (Pteromys volans orii), photographed during breeding season. The individual higher up on the tree is a female in oestrus. In the first two images in this sequence of three, the male approaches the female from behind to attempt copulation. In the third image, the female spins around to indicate in no uncertain terms that she is not ready. The pair’s nest is in the crack in the tree.
